Harvard vs. Neumann

VFX info at vfx.hu
Wed Dec 14 10:52:28 CET 2005


Hali!

Rancz Lajos wrote:
> 
> Hali!
> 
> Köszi mindenkinek a válaszokat. Sikerült megerõsödnöm abban a
> gondolatomban, hogy mindenHarvard architektúra csak nem biztos, hogy
> látszik :-)) Érdekes a VFX által is említett SHARC, az nem tudom minek
> számít mivel közös memóriában van az adat és a program, csak dualportos
> ezért egy órajel alatt tud olvasni adatot és utasítást :-) Definició
> szerint ez mi?

Nem, nincs egy memoriaban, illetve meg is :). A program memoriat csak a
PX regiszterrel tudod elerni SW-bol (ha utasitast akarsz irni/olvasni).
Az igaz, hogy a DAG is tudja adatkent hasznalni a program memoriat, de
ez tenyleg csak a dualport miatt megy neki. Sot akarmelyik DAG nem is
tudja hasznalni a prg.memoriat.
A kulso SDRAM mar mas teszta. A Proci labaig kozos az utjuk, de onnan
egybol szetvalik es az utasitas megy a PA buszra 48 biten, mig a data a
DA buszra 32 biten (vagy 64). Viszont itt mar nem is egy orajelesek az
utasitasok :( 

Blackfinnel meg durvabb a helyzet, mert a programmemoriat csak DMA-vel
lehet elerni, sem olvasni sem irni nem tudod direktben. Persze az SDRAM
itt is kivetel, mert jogosultsag beallithato ugy hogy program es data
azonos cimen legyen, igy nem fog pampogni, ha datakent akarsz program
teruletre irni. De csak kulso memoriaval muxik. A belsore azonnal
exception-t general...

UDV. VFX.
http://www.vfx.hu




More information about the Elektro mailing list